Range Creek Roundup Starts Next Week — Western Horse Watchers Association

BLM said today that that approximately 125 wild horses will be gathered from the Range Creek HMA in Carbon County, UT, starting July 1. The operation will be carried out with helicopters and will be open to public observation. The HMA covers 55,023 acres and has an AML of 125, for an aimed-at stocking rate […]Range …

Take action for wild horses — Tuesday’s Horse

Help end conflicts between wild horses and public land ranchers The Voluntary Grazing Retirement Act — H.R. 5737 — would benefit wild horses and burros by providing another way to settle land and resource conflicts. H.R. 5737 would also allow third parties, like wild horse or environmental organizations, to compensate livestock grazing permittees who choose […] …
